Position Available: Configuration Manager

Location: Hertfordshire (Hybrid – 2 days in office per week)

Salary: £50,000 – £55,000 + Benefits

Experience needed: Proven experience in applying and leading Configuration Management practices within a complex engineering environment such as aerospace, automotive, defence or manufacturing.

About the role:

We are seeking an experienced Configuration Manager to work on some of the most advanced and innovative engineering programmes in the UK. This role is key to maintaining the integrity and control of technical data and documentation across the full lifecycle of highly complex products.

You\’ll work closely with cross-functional teams across engineering, manufacturing, quality, and project management to ensure robust configuration governance is in place from concept through to delivery and in-service support. You will play a strategic and hands-on role, leading the implementation of configuration management principles and driving improvements to policy, process, and tooling.

What we need from you:

  • Strong experience in Configuration Management, ideally within complex manufacturing or engineering environments
  • Strong understanding of configuration principles, processes, and standards
  • Proven ability to plan and deliver configuration activities, including baseline management, version control, and change management
  • Experience analysing and improving configuration processes, with a focus on compliance, traceability, and product integrity
  • Confident communicator with the ability to influence stakeholders and enforce process adherence across multidisciplinary teams
  • It would be beneficial to have a background of working in complex product development environments
